Asked by GuruZ2M4Q Nov 26, 2017 at 04:55 PM about the 2010 GMC Terrain SLT1

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

A couple of weeks ago my car battery died my car
was left overnight and the next morning I jumped it
(apparently I jumped it from the fuse box not the
battery) I thought it was correct because the car
started but since then the computer system has
just been out of whack. The screen is just digital
lines there's a light on once in awhile it will go
black and come right back to the screen.

These particular base radios were made horribly from the get-go. I think they're literally designed to die. What you're going to have to do is replace the head unit inside the dashboard. There is no other way around this. The video output of the head unit has failed. If you get a used unit, you'll have to take a trip to the dealer only to unlock it.
